Do novice runners have weak hips and bad running form?
Anne Schmitz1, Kelsey Russo1, Lauren Edwards1
1Division of Physical Therapy, University of Kentucky, Lexington, KY, USA.
Novice female runners show a trend toward increased hip internal rotation, linked to decreased trunk endurance, not hip strength. Injury prevention programs should focus on trunk stability and hip control.
Area of Science:
- Biomechanics
- Sports Medicine
- Running Injury Prevention
Background:
- Novice runners are predisposed to injuries.
- Understanding running mechanics and strength differences is crucial for injury prevention.
Purpose of the Study:
- Identify differences in running mechanics and strength between novice and experienced female runners.
- Assess the relationship between hip/trunk strength and non-sagittal hip kinematics in runners.
Main Methods:
- Recruited 19 novice and 19 experienced female runners.
- Measured hip abductor/external rotator strength and trunk endurance (side-plank).
- Performed instrumented gait analysis at 3.3m/s; analyzed impact peak, loading rate, and hip kinematics.
Main Results:
- No significant differences found in impact peak, loading rate, hip kinematics, or strength between groups.
- Novice runners exhibited a trend toward increased peak hip internal rotation (3.8°).
- Decreased trunk side-plank endurance correlated with increased peak hip internal rotation (r=-0.357, p=0.03).
Conclusions:
- Injury prevention for novice runners should target trunk performance and hip neuromuscular control.
- Hip strength alone was not significantly related to running kinematics in this cohort.
